I went on a long weekend to Las Vegas with a girl friend for a "girls get away" this past weekend. Had lots of fun. She knew I had the surgery and has been a great supporter. As our time went on, I realized how different it would have been if we did this a year ago, pre-VSG. I would have waited behind for her to go run around instead of walking 8+ miles a day. I would have been planning our Breakfast, lunch, dinner, food treats, etc. instead of oops...we didn't get lunch. I would have been planning at least one nap if I wanted to stay up late, instead of going 36 hours w/o sleep the first day. After that about 4 hours a night. I would have felt out of place and awkward around all of the twenty-somethings in the places we went thinking they were looking at me. I think I would have croaked going up and down the broken escalotors around the strip. Instead I scaled them like a teen, and even passed a gasping 12 year old. The plane travel was also so much better. I usually get a window seat. Not only because I like the view, but because it was one less person I was inconveniencing - I could squish against the window. This time it was actually comfortable...dare I say roomy. I stepped on the scale this morning, and I'm 1.5lbs down. Who loses weight on vacation? The changes we go through are kind of gradual even though our clothing is getting smaller. It took something like this to really see what a change it's made to me. It's really awesome.
